Headquartered in Kowloon, Hong Kong, hmvod Limited functions as an investment holding company with a primary focus on operations within the People's Republic of China. Formerly known as Trillion Grand Corporate Company Limited until October 2018, the firm's business activities span several key areas. Its Professional Services segment provides expertise in information technology engineering, technical support, financial valuation, and general IT solutions. The company also manages a Proprietary Trading division, actively participating in the trading of listed securities. A significant portion of its business is dedicated to its Over-the-Top (OTT) Services, which involves the production and distribution of films, television programs, and music content via digital platforms. Additionally, hmvod Limited extends its offerings to include cybersecurity services and solutions, alongside other multimedia and content-related provisions.

What is a company's Operating Margin?
The operating margin is a key indicator to assess the profitability of a company. Higher operating margins are generaly better as they show that a company is able to sell its products or services for much more than their production costs. The operating margin is calculated by dividing a company's earnings by its revenue.
